Music Review: Justin Timberlake & T.I. "My Love"

Justin Timberlake & T.I.

My Love
Album: FutureSex/LoveSounds
Year: 2006

Justin Timberlake proposes to his girlfriend in the stunning “My Love.”

He opens the single by saying that his girlfriend can’t be replaced. It leads to the vibrating synths, setting a breathless tone.
“Ain't another woman that can take your spot my.”


In the first verse, he asks if she would appreciate a symphony he worked on to express his feelings. He also wonders if the compliments he gives her impress her and want to spend every day with him. He says he’s traveled to Europe, Australia, Japan, and Africa and met many girls. However, she is the one who stands out. He gets on bended knee and says the diamond is a symbol of his deep feelings for her. He adds a “yes” answer would complete him.

In the chorus, he says he envisions them taking late night strolls on the beach and resting among the quiet of the trees in silence. He promises he’s not going psychotic on her if she says no. He just wants her to stay with him.

In the second verse, he says if he took the time to write a love letter, would she be pleased with what he said. He wonders if she would want to make a commitment to him. He says they’ve been dating long enough and it’s a natural progression in their relationship.

The chorus is sung again.

Rapper T.I. says Timberlake’s girlfriend is great. He tells her to forget any other guys she may have still have feelings for. T.I. says Timberlake is a man who will treat her right. Then, he rambles on about himself and tries to steal Timberlake’s girlfriend for himself.

The chorus is sung again to close the single.

He’s ready to get married. However he’s not sure if she’s on the same page. He tries to gauge her reaction to his sentiments. If she is excited and hugs him, he will assume she is as much in love with him as he is with her.

His hoarse falsetto vocals are sensitive and bared. In previous singles, his falsetto has been polished and cleaned up. It was technically well-done but hollow. The imperfection in it adds a rawness the single wouldn’t have otherwise.

T.I. isn't needed to make the song any better. The original intent was likely to have T.I. appear on the song and have Timberlake benefit from it. However, T.I. it's who has to work to make himself noticed and given the caliber of the single, he didn't put in much effort.

The courtly, house dance arrangement has dainty, nervy beats, expressing Timberlake’s fear that she may say no to his proposal. It’s unbelievable that a) he can pull it off as though the genre were his first love and b) possibly make the sound mainstream. But it’s true – he makes the house genre his home.

The fantastic “My Love” is a challenging step forward for Timberlake.
